#![doc = "Networking HW rate limiting configuration.\n\nThis API allows configuring HW shapers available on the network devices\nat different levels (queues, network device) and allows arbitrary\nmanipulation of the scheduling tree of the involved shapers.\n\nEach \\@shaper is identified within the given device, by a \\@handle,\ncomprising both a \\@scope and an \\@id.\n\nDepending on the \\@scope value, the shapers are attached to specific HW\nobjects (queues, devices) or, for \\@node scope, represent a scheduling\ngroup, that can be placed in an arbitrary location of the scheduling\ntree.\n\nShapers can be created with two different operations: the \\@set\noperation, to create and update a single \\\"attached\\\" shaper, and the\n\\@group operation, to create and update a scheduling group. Only the\n\\@group operation can create \\@node scope shapers.\n\nExisting shapers can be deleted/reset via the \\@delete operation.\n\nThe user can query the running configuration via the \\@get operation.\n\nDifferent devices can provide different feature sets, e.g. with no\nsupport for complex scheduling hierarchy, or for some shaping\nparameters. The user can introspect the HW capabilities via the\n\\@cap-get operation.\n"]

#[doc = "Clear (remove) the specified shaper. When deleting a \\@node shaper,\nreattach all the node\\'s leaves to the deleted node\\'s parent. If, after\nthe removal, the parent shaper has no more leaves and the parent shaper\nscope is \\@node, the parent node is deleted, recursively. When deleting\na \\@queue shaper or a \\@netdev shaper, the shaper disappears from the\nhierarchy, but the queue/device can still send traffic: it has an\nimplicit node with infinite bandwidth. The queue\\'s implicit node feeds\nan implicit RR node at the root of the hierarchy.\n\nFlags: admin-perm\n\nRequest attributes:\n- [.nested_handle()](PushNetShaper::nested_handle)\n- [.push_ifindex()](PushNetShaper::push_ifindex)\n\n"]

#[doc = "Create or update a scheduling group, attaching the specified \\@leaves\nshapers under the specified node identified by \\@handle. The \\@leaves\nshapers scope must be \\@queue and the node shaper scope must be either\n\\@node or \\@netdev. When the node shaper has \\@node scope, if the\n\\@handle \\@id is not specified, a new shaper of such scope is created,\notherwise the specified node must already exist. When updating an\nexisting node shaper, the specified \\@leaves are added to the existing\nnode; such node will also retain any preexisting leave. The \\@parent\nhandle for a new node shaper defaults to the parent of all the leaves,\nprovided all the leaves share the same parent. Otherwise \\@parent handle\nmust be specified. The user can optionally provide shaping attributes\nfor the node shaper. The operation is atomic, on failure no change is\napplied to the device shaping configuration, otherwise the \\@node shaper\nfull identifier, comprising \\@binding and \\@handle, is provided as the\nreply.\n\nFlags: admin-perm\n\nRequest attributes:\n- [.nested_handle()](PushNetShaper::nested_handle)\n- [.push_metric()](PushNetShaper::push_metric)\n- [.push_bw_min()](PushNetShaper::push_bw_min)\n- [.push_bw_max()](PushNetShaper::push_bw_max)\n- [.push_burst()](PushNetShaper::push_burst)\n- [.push_priority()](PushNetShaper::push_priority)\n- [.push_weight()](PushNetShaper::push_weight)\n- [.push_ifindex()](PushNetShaper::push_ifindex)\n- [.nested_parent()](PushNetShaper::nested_parent)\n- [.nested_leaves()](PushNetShaper::nested_leaves)\n\nReply attributes:\n- [.get_handle()](IterableNetShaper::get_handle)\n- [.get_ifindex()](IterableNetShaper::get_ifindex)\n\n"]
